Latest Patents

Bair's latest patents include innovative methods for forming electrical interconnects that incorporate electromigration-inhibiting segments. One of his patents describes a method of forming an electrical conductor by creating electrically conductive segments that include electromigration-inhibiting plugs. This process involves forming a row of windows in a planar surface, followed by the deposition of electromigration-inhibiting material into these windows. The plugs are created by depositing an electromigration-inhibiting liner and then filling the windows with electrically conductive material. The final steps involve removing portions of the plugs and conductive segments to achieve a coplanar surface. This method is particularly useful in the manufacture of integrated circuit conductors.

Another patent focuses on a similar method of forming electrical interconnects with electromigration-inhibiting plugs. The process is designed to ensure that the plugs, conductive segments, and dielectric surface are coplanar, enhancing the reliability and performance of electrical conductors.
